2220Y0250102JFT - Knowles Syfer - Ceramic Capacitors

2220Y0250102JFT

Knowles Syfer

CAP CER 1000PF 25V C0G/NP0 2220

2220Y0250102JFT is a Ceramic Capacitors manufactured by Knowles Syfer. CAP CER 1000PF 25V C0G/NP0 2220. Key specifications: mounting type Surface Mount, MLCC, operating temperature -55°C ~ 125°C, voltage - rated 25V, package / case 2220 (5750 Metric).
